Provider Score in 40176, Webster, Kentucky

The Provider Score for the Asthma Score in 40176, Webster, Kentucky is 7 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

An estimate of 100.00 percent of the residents in 40176 has some form of health insurance. 65.07 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 62.50 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ase. Military veterans should know that percent of the residents in the ZIP Code of 40176 have VA health insurance. Also, percent of the residents receive TRICARE.

For the 201 residents under the age of 18, there is an estimate of 0 pediatricians in a 20-mile radius of 40176. An estimate of 0 geriatricians or physicians who focus on the elderly who can serve the 124 residents over the age of 65 years.

In a 20-mile radius, there are 240 health care providers accessible to residents in 40176, Webster, Kentucky.

ZIP Code 40176, encompassing the town of Sebree, Kentucky, presents a unique healthcare landscape. Rural areas often face challenges in healthcare access, and the presence of specialized asthma care may be limited. Primary care physicians are frequently the first point of contact for asthma patients, making their expertise and resources crucial.

Physician-to-patient ratios are a critical indicator of accessibility. A higher ratio, indicating more patients per physician, can lead to longer wait times, potentially delayed diagnoses, and less time for patient education and management. Data from the Kentucky Board of Medical Licensure, combined with population estimates for ZIP Code 40176, will be necessary to ascertain the physician-to-patient ratio. This ratio is a significant factor in determining the ‘Asthma Score.’ A lower ratio, indicating greater access, would contribute positively to the score.

Identifying ‘standout practices’ involves evaluating clinics and individual physicians known for their commitment to asthma care. This includes assessing the availability of spirometry testing, a crucial diagnostic tool for asthma. Practices that offer comprehensive asthma action plans, patient education materials, and regular follow-up appointments will receive higher marks. Reviews from patients, if available, can provide valuable insights into the quality of care. Practices demonstrating proactive management, such as regular asthma control assessments and medication adjustments, will be recognized.

Telemedicine adoption has the potential to significantly improve asthma care access, especially in rural areas. Telemedicine allows patients to consult with physicians remotely, reducing the need for travel and minimizing disruption to daily life. The ‘Asthma Score’ will reflect the extent to which practices in ZIP Code 40176 utilize telemedicine for asthma management. Practices offering virtual consultations, remote monitoring of peak flow meters, and medication refills via telemedicine will receive favorable consideration.

The link between asthma and mental health is well-established. Asthma can trigger anxiety and depression, and these conditions can exacerbate asthma symptoms. The ‘Asthma Score’ will evaluate the availability of mental health resources within primary care practices. Practices that offer on-site mental health services, referrals to mental health specialists, or integrate mental health screening into asthma management will be viewed more favorably. The integration of mental health support is crucial for holistic asthma care.
